Most of us rarely think about how the weather affects the clothes we wear. Yet climate—especially humidity and drought—plays a major role in how the materials in your pants behave, feel, and last over time. Whether you prefer jeans, khakis, or joggers, changes in air moisture, temperature, and sunlight can alter the fit, comfort, and durability of your favorite pair. Here’s how climate conditions across the U.S. can influence your pants—and what you can do to keep them in good shape.

Humidity: When Fibers Soak It Up

High humidity causes many textile fibers to absorb moisture and expand. This is particularly true for natural materials like cotton, linen, and wool. When fibers take in water, they become softer and more flexible—but also heavier and slower to dry. That can make your pants feel clammy and cause them to lose some of their shape.

  • Cotton absorbs moisture easily, which makes it comfortable in warm weather but less ideal in humid regions like the Gulf Coast, where it can feel heavy and damp.
  • Wool can take in moisture without feeling wet, but it needs careful drying to avoid shrinking.
  • Linen dries quickly, making it great for muggy summers, though it wrinkles easily when humidity fluctuates.

If you live in a humid area—say, Florida or the Pacific Northwest—it’s worth choosing pants that blend natural fibers with synthetics. A bit of polyester or spandex helps the fabric hold its shape and dry faster.

Drought and Heat: When Fibers Tighten Up

In dry, hot climates, the opposite happens: fibers lose moisture and contract. This can make pants feel stiffer and less flexible. Over time, repeated cycles of moisture gain and loss can weaken fibers and shorten the life of the fabric.

Synthetic materials like polyester and nylon are less affected by dryness, but they can become static-prone and attract dust when the air is very dry. If you live in places like Arizona, Nevada, or inland California, using a fabric softener or antistatic spray can help keep your pants comfortable and clean.

Sun and UV Exposure: The Hidden Foe

While humidity and dryness are the most noticeable factors, sunlight also plays a big role. UV rays can fade dyes and weaken fibers—especially in natural materials. Dark jeans left to dry in direct sunlight can lose color quickly, and elastic fibers like spandex can lose their stretch when exposed to too much heat and sun.

A simple tip: dry your pants in the shade and avoid leaving them in a hot car or near a heater. It helps preserve both color and fabric strength.

How to Care for Pants in Changing Climates

Whether you live in a humid coastal city or a dry inland region, a few habits can help extend the life of your pants:

  • Wash less often – frequent washing wears down fibers and removes natural oils that protect the fabric.
  • Use cool water – high temperatures can cause shrinkage and reduce elasticity.
  • Air dry naturally – drying in the shade is best for both the environment and your clothes.
  • Store in balanced conditions – avoid damp basements and overly dry, heated rooms.
  • Turn pants inside out before washing or drying to protect color and surface texture.

Climate as Part of Your Wardrobe

When we talk about sustainability and clothing, we often focus on production and materials. But the climate you live in is just as important. By understanding how humidity, drought, and sunlight affect your pants, you can make smarter choices—and take better care of what you already own.

It’s not just about making your clothes last longer; it’s about feeling comfortable every day. After all, the climate doesn’t just shape the world around us—it shapes how we feel in our clothes, too.
